Welcome to Linworth!

http://www.linworth.org/wp-content/uploads/2017/09/DrBowers01292019.mp4

The Linworth Experiential Program opened in the fall of 1973 as an option for high school students in the Worthington City Schools. The purpose of the program is to more fully engage students in their educations by creating choices and having students make choices, placing the students in situations requiring higher levels of responsibility and having students learn and apply what they have learned through experiential education.
